Choosing where to begin a career in massage therapy is a deeply personal decision. For many students, the right environment matters just as much as the curriculum itself. This is where a Wheatland massage school can stand out as a strong local option—not because it tries to compete with big-city institutions, but because it leans into community, accessibility, and hands-on education that feels grounded and real.
Wheatland offers something that larger metro areas often lack: focus. Students aren’t lost in overcrowded classrooms or rushed through programs designed for volume rather than mastery. Instead, a Wheatland massage school typically emphasizes individualized instruction, allowing aspiring massage therapists to build confidence at a steady pace. That personal attention can make a significant difference when learning complex subjects like anatomy, kinesiology, and therapeutic techniques.
Another major strength of local massage schools is how closely their training aligns with real-world practice. Programs often blend massage therapy fundamentals with practical exposure, helping students understand how techniques translate from the classroom to the treatment room. This is especially valuable for those interested in complementary roles such as a physical therapy aide technician, where knowledge of muscle function and client care must be both technical and intuitive.
The community connection also plays a powerful role. A Wheatland massage school tends to have strong relationships with nearby clinics, wellness centers, and healthcare providers. These local ties can open doors to internships, mentorships, and employment opportunities after graduation. Learning within the same community where you plan to work allows you to build professional relationships early, long before you hang your license on the wall.
